Note The cluster standby group is an HSRP group. Disabling HSRP disables the cluster standby group.
The switches in the cluster standby group are ranked according to HSRP priorities. The switch with the
highest priority in the group is the active command switch (AC). The switch with the next highest
priority is the standby command switch (SC). The other switches in the cluster standby group are the
passive command switches (PC). If the active command switch and the standby command switch become
disabled at the same time, the passive command switch with the highest priority becomes the active
command switch. For the limitations to automatic discovery, see the “Automatic Recovery of Cluster
Configuration” section on page 5-11. For information about changing HSRP priority values, refer to the
standby priority interface configuration mode command in the Cisco IOS Release 12.1 documentation
set. The HSRP commands are the same for changing the priority of cluster standby group members and
router-redundancy group members.
Note The HSRP standby hold time interval should be greater than or equal to 3 times the hello time interval.
The default HSRP standby hold time interval is 10 seconds. The default HSRP standby hello time
interval is 3 seconds. For more information about the standby hold time and hello time intervals, refer
to the Cisco IOS Release 12.1 documentation set on Cisco.com.

Virtual IP Addresses
You need to assign a unique virtual IP address and group number and name to the cluster standby group.
This information must be configured on the management VLAN on the active command switch. The
active command switch receives traffic destined for the virtual IP address. To manage the cluster, you
must access the active command switch through the virtual IP address, not through the command-switch
IP address. This is in case the IP address of the active command switch is different from the virtual IP
address of the cluster standby group.
If the active command switch fails, the standby command switch assumes ownership of the virtual IP
address and becomes the active command switch. The passive switches in the cluster standby group
compare their assigned priorities to determine the new standby command switch. The passive standby
switch with the highest priority then becomes the standby command switch. When the previously active
command switch becomes active again, it resumes its role as the active command switch, and the current
active command switch becomes the standby command switch again. For more information about IP
address in switch clusters, see the “IP Addresses” section on page 5-12.
